old.ubuntu-desktop.ru - ОТСЛЕЖИВАЕМ СЕТЕВУЮ АКТИВНОСТЬ ОТДЕЛЬНЫХ ПРОЦЕССОВ - Команды терминала Главная > Каталог статей > Команды терминала
ОТСЛЕЖИВАЕМ СЕТЕВУЮ АКТИВНОСТЬ ОТДЕЛЬНЫХ ПРОЦЕССОВ
Утилита NetHogs помогает отследить сетевую активность отдельных процессов, позволяет получать подробную статистику по использовании Ваших сетевых соединений, с разбиением информации по протоколам или подсетям.
NetHogs показывает ID (PID) процесса для каждого приложения, название программы, имя сетевого интерфейса, скорость передачи данных (в кБ). Список сортирован по скорости передачи данных.
Для работы с утилитой требуются прав администратора (root).
Утилита NetHogs доступна в официальном репозитории Ubuntu, поэтому ее можно установить через центр приложений Ubuntu или воспользоваться терминалом:
sudo apt-get install nethogs
Сетевые интерфейсы в Ubuntu Linux lo — Интерфейс петли обратной связи eth — Сетевой интерфейс к карте Ethernet или картам WaveLan (Radio Ethernet) tr — Сетевой интерфейс к карте Token Ring ppp — Сетевой интерфейс к каналу PPP (Point-to-Point Protocol) sl — Сетевой интерфейс к каналу SLIP (Serial Line IP) plip — Сетевой интерфейс к каналу PLIP (Parallel Line IP). Используется для организации сетевого взаимодействия с использованием параллельного порта ax — Сетевой интерфейс к устройствам любительского радио AX.25 fddi — Сетевой интерфейс к карте FDDI arc0e, arc0s — Сетевой интерфейс к карте ArcNet. Используется инкапсуляция пакетов в формате Ethernet или RFC 1051 Для определения Ваших активных сетевых интерфейсов воспользуйтесь командой:
ifconfig
Пример:
ifconfig
eth0 Link encap:Ethernet HWaddr 94:de:80:94:f1:ed
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
Для быстрой очистки кэша памяти можно использовать команду:
sudo -i
echo 3 > /proc/sys/vm/drop_caches
exit
При этом произойдет очистка кэша inode, dentrie и PageCache.
Виды кэша:
PageCache или страничный кэш — это место, куда ядро складывает все данные, которые вы записывали или читали из диска. Это очень сильно ускоряет работу системы, так как если программе во второй раз понадобятся те же данные, они просто будут взяты из…
Zero Ballistics — бесплатная игра, танковый аркадный симулятор для Linux (танковый шутер от первого лица). В игру можно играть только через Интернет или по сети. В Zero Ballistics имеются несколько видов танков и видов оружия, а так же можно менять вид. В игре нет опции — одиночная игра, но серверов к которым можно подключится много.
Игра доступна для Linux и Windows.
Официальный сайт игры…
Цикл с предусловием while.
Цикл while исполняется пока условие истинно. Записывается он так:
while( условие ){
Код;
}
Пример 1:
$n=1;
while($n < 10){
echo $n;
$n += 2;
}
Цикл выведет все нечетные числа от 1 до 9
13579
Пример 2:
$i=0;
$a=array(1,2,3,4,5,6,7,8,9);
while($i<count($a)){
echo $a[$i];
$i++;
}
Цикл выведет все элементы массива, так как функция count($a) определяет кол-во элементов массива.
123456789
Бывает так, что при какой-то ситуации цикл while должен…
Ranger консольный файловый менеджер. Имеет по умолчанию трех панельный интерфейс, для каталога, списка файлов каталога и третья панель для просмотра файлов.
Файловый менеджер не очень удобен для операций копирования и перемещения, но весьма удобен для навигации, поиска и просмотра.
Программу можно установить через "Центр приложений Ubuntu" или выполнив команду в терминале:
sudo apt-get install…
FlightGear бесплатная игра-авиастимулятор. Игра достаточно реалистична, может быть использована в обучающих целях. FlightGear обладает огромным числом возможностей, таких как реалистичность модели полета, реальные погодные условия, тысячи моделей аэропортов и много другое. FlightGear это даже не игра, а самый настоящий авиостимулятор.
В авиостимуляторе доступны множество моделей самолетов и вертолетов, так же…